Tanner, AL — The Tanner Rattlers will take on the Woodville Panthers at 5:00 p.m. on Monday. Tanner will be strutting in after a victory while Woodville will be coming in after a loss.
Tanner is looking to give their home crowd another W after opening their season at home on Monday. They had just enough and edged out Cherokee 7-6.
Ashley Lagrone and Trae Malone were major factors no matter where they played. On the mound, Lagrone struck out eight batters over three innings while giving up just two earned (and two unearned) runs off one hit. Meanwhile, Malone pitched three innings while giving up no earned runs off one hit. At the plate, Lagrone got on base in two of his three plate appearances with two stolen bases, while Malone went a perfect 2-for-2 with three runs, two doubles, and one stolen base. Those two doubles gave Malone a new career-high.
In other batting news, Jaden Williams was incredible, going a perfect 3-for-3 with three stolen bases, three RBI, and one run. Those three hits gave him a new career-high. Saban Long was another key player, going 1-for-2 with one stolen base, two RBI, and one run.
Meanwhile, Woodville was not able to break out of their rough patch on Friday as the team picked up their fourth straight defeat dating back to last season. They fell 7-4 to Mae Jemison.
Braxton Talley was cooking despite his team's loss, going 2-for-3 with one triple, one run, and one RBI.
Tanner couldn't quite finish off Woodville in their previous meeting back in April of 2025 and fell 19-17. Can the Rattlers av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
